Three rickettsioses, Darnley Island, Australia
Nathan B Unsworth1, John Stenos, Antony G Faa
1The Australian Rickettsial Reference Laboratory, Geelong, Victoria, Australia.
Emerging Infectious Diseases
|January 25, 2008
Summary
Three rickettsioses cases were identified on Darnley Island, Australia. This included Flinders Island spotted fever, Queensland tick typhus, and scrub typhus caused by a unique Orientia tsutsugamushi strain.

Observation:
- Three distinct rickettsioses were diagnosed in patients on Darnley Island, Australia.
- Cases included Flinders Island spotted fever (Rickettsia honei strain "marmionii").
- One case of Queensland tick typhus (Rickettsia australis) and two cases of scrub typhus (Orientia tsutsugamushi) were identified.
Findings:
- The study identified a diverse range of rickettsial pathogens in a specific Australian locale.
- A unique strain of Orientia tsutsugamushi was implicated in scrub typhus cases.
- This highlights the potential for novel or underreported rickettsial strains in the region.

Rocky Mountain Spotted Fever
Rocky Mountain Spotted Fever (RMSF) is a severe tick-borne illness caused by Rickettsia rickettsii, a Gram-negative, coccobacillary bacterium. This pathogen is an obligate intracellular parasite, requiring a host cell for replication. Transmission occurs through the bite of an infected tick. In the United States, the most important vectors are Dermacentor variabilis (American dog tick) and Dermacentor andersoni (Rocky Mountain wood tick), though other tick species may also serve as vectors.

Plague
Plague is a highly virulent zoonotic disease caused by Yersinia pestis, a Gram-negative, facultatively anaerobic coccobacillus. This pathogen primarily circulates among rodent populations and is transmitted to humans through the bite of infected fleas. Additional transmission routes include direct contact with infected animal tissue or inhalation of respiratory droplets from individuals with pneumonic plague.
